Олимпиадный тренинг

Задача . Сортировка по трем параметрам - 2


Программа получает на вход набор чисел. Отсортируйте данный набор  по сумме четных цифр числа. Список должен быть отсортирован в порядке возрастания. При равенстве суммы четных цифр, числа должны идти в порядке увеличения количества нечетных цифр. При равенстве суммы четных цифр и количества нечетных, числа должны идти в в порядке убывания. Используйте встроенную функцию сортировки.


Входные данные
Программа получает на вход в первой строке число n - количество чисел. Далее идут n строк, в каждой из которой записано одно число по модулю не превышающее 109.

Выходные данные
Выведите отсортированный набор чисел. Каждое число необходимо вывести в отдельной строке. 
 
Примеры
Входные данныеВыходные данные
1
5
123
213
221
431
407
213
123
407
221
431

time 1000 ms
memory 256 Mb
Правила оформления программ и список ошибок при автоматической проверке задач

Статистика успешных решений по компиляторам
Комментарий учителя